ABOUT THE COUNTRY CLUB OF MISSOURI
COLUMBIA, MO | The Country Club of Missouri is the only Member-owned and managed country club in Columbia, Missouri. Established in 1971, our traditions surround family and community. Our Club offers a challenging golf course, state-of-the-art tennis courts, a large pool with spray ground, excellent dining and event facilities and activities for all Members to enjoy. Whether you are looking for a place to relax, to play a round of golf or enjoy happy hour with friends, CCMO is the premier Club in Mid-Missouri.
The par 72, 18-hole championship golf course is nestled in southwest Columbia with a traditional layout designed by Dr. Marvin Ferguson. The golf course is 'player friendly' with zoysia fairways, bluegrass rough and bent grass greens that have subtle breaks providing a challenge for all levels of golfers. In addition to the golf course, we offer a practice facility including a practice tee, a short game area and a putting green. The junior golf program is very active and a benefit to young families.
The club boasts an active tennis and pickleball program complete with five tennis courts, four pickle ball courts, tennis shop and patio. The food and beverage options at CCMO delivers member dining, activities, poolside options, and the event center. The Club has several venues to serve its members and the event center is unique to the metro area of 250,000 residents.
CCMO is the place to be each summer! The swim facility includes open swim, lap lanes, splash ground, locker rooms, tiki bar and kitchen. Children's activities include private and group swimming lessons, swim team and summer camps. Activities such as Dive-In Movies and Late Night Swims are fun for the whole family. If you want to stay active, join our aquacise group or dive into one of our lap lanes. The CCMO Pool is a great place to relax in the sun or have a snack in the shade.

JOB SUMMARY
Head Golf Professional:
The ideal candidate will work closely with the General Manager to ensure a seamless, member hospitality-driven operation at the club. This position focuses on the member experience, retail services, oversight of golf shop, outside services operations, and management of the golf professionals and related responsibilities. This is a hands-on position that will ensure the highest standards of service, safety, comfort, organization, presentation, and direct all department activities, projects and programs. The creative, collaborative and resourceful head golf professional will lead the golf department in accord with CCMO culture and policies.

SKILL SET & RESPONSIBILITIES
Oversight of the golf department and golf professional team, including operations, retail, events, and player development.
Promote the game of golf amongst the CCMO membership including coaching, golfing with members, supporting the PGA of America and Missouri Golf Association.
Represent the CCMO brand within the Columbia community.
Foster teamwork within the golf department and in concert with each of the other departments.
Approach each day at the Club with a mindset of helping others and continued improvement.
Create, execute, and collaborate on ideas that drive demand and financial success of the golf department and Club.
Assist in implementing applicable operating, human resources, and safety policies and procedures pertaining to golf shop and outside service activities. Ensure procedures are followed to open, close, and secure the golf shop and storage buildings.
Ensure accurate tracking of course utilization by members and guests. Monitor member preferences, usage patterns, and satisfaction with company products and services. Assess the quality of internal and external customer service and pace of play. Recommend and execute plans for continued improvement.
Supervise and train all golf shop staff in selling techniques and ensure they are enhancing the retail experience of members, guests, outings, and member-based companies.
Maintains levels of product appropriate for the season and level of traffic through golf shop.
Maximize financial performance by updating the open-to-buy plan within budgetary and cash flow guidelines.
Maintains an attractive and orderly appearance in and around the golf shop. Partner with golf staff and General Manager on annual AGM Platinum Golf Shop Award submission.
Maintains product documentation from purchase to sale - including purchase orders, receiving records, invoice validation/payment, inventory records and special-order records to document merchandise history.
Conducts accurate and timely physical inventory counts.
Update and maintain policies/procedures and job descriptions for areas of supervision and direct reports. Collaborate with the team to set goals, expectations, and accountability.
Develop and manage an innovative tournament services program for golf groups and golf outings. The club hosts several member and member-sponsored golf events throughout the year. A working knowledge of Golf Genius Premium is important.
Working knowledge of member website and social media platforms.
Monitor facility activities and make recommendations to improve member service and/or operational efficiencies.
Assure the efficient and timely submission of all required inventories, operational, financial, budgetary, marketing and sales reports for golf operations.
Collaborating with the General Manager and Controller, create, seasonalize and implement the annual operating budget for the golf department.
Manage employment activities for applicable staff members including recruitment and selection, performance evaluations, training, compensation, payroll preparation, corrective action, and termination, etc. in compliance with human resources policies and procedures.
Plan departmental work and staffing schedules to achieve quality standards with responsible labor costs.
Conduct staff meetings to ensure coordination of departmental activities as well as with other departments.
Maintain accurate records pertaining to department activities including, but not limited to, labor schedules, building maintenance, equipment repair, safety meetings, activities, etc.
